ADMINISTRATION Crown Point Schools welcomed two new administrators this year . . . J. Russel Hiatt as super¬ intendent, and Austin Walker as principal. Our school board mem¬ bers are Floyd Vance, secretary; Lowell Held, president; and Julius Greisel, treasurer. Protecting our freedom of speech and showing us how to use it to our best advantage are the lan¬ guage department teachers: op¬ posite page Miss Lauterbur, English, Journalism, and sponsor of THE INKLINGS; Miss Swartz English, Latin, and speech; Mrs. Tyler, English, Spanish and de¬ bate; Miss McKenzie, English and sponsor of EXCALIBUR; and Mrs. Mracek, English; Miss Shelby is our librarian, and di¬ rects the Junior and Senior plays. Whatever you were this year . . . water-boy, cheer¬ leader, student, staff member or innodent bystander it doesn’t matter . . . because it’s a good bet you had fun anyway. The right to express ourselves freely is the basis for the American belief in every individual’s ability to shape his own destiny. In¬ stead of taking it for granted let’s remember that if the young people of a good many countries were given the opportunity to “be themselves” and not puppets they would regard it as a duty and re¬ sponsibility, not a freedom. A good baseball player knows that using his glove every day keeps it flex¬ ible and in good condition . . . freedoms are the same way . . . using them keeps them flexible. Say what you think (after you think, of course!). And it will keep your mind in condition to meet the everchanging demands of the future! TO EXPRESS OURSELVES
